Library Corner, Nov. 24 edition

by | Nov 22, 2021 | Featured

For more information on any of the following programs or other activities at the library, visit hopkintonlibrary.org. The library also can be found on Facebook, @hopkintonlibrary, and on Twitter, @HopkintonPLMA.

Library Schedule Update
The library will be closed on Thursday, Nov. 25, and Friday, Nov. 26, for Thanksgiving. The library already is closed every Saturday and Sunday. Library staff wishes everyone a happy and healthy holiday. There also is a possibility of an early closure on Wednesday, Nov. 24. Updates will be posted to the library website.

Yoga With Natasha Linton
Mondays, Nov. 29 and Dec. 6, noon (Zoom)
Register via the library’s website calendar.

Freedom Team Book Group
Tuesday, Nov. 30, 7-8 p.m. (Zoom)
This month the Freedom Team Book Club is reading “Ring Shout” by P. Djèlí Clark. Copies are available at the main floor circulation desk for pickup. Register via the library’s website calendar.

Conversation Circles
Friday, Dec. 3, 10:30 a.m.-noon (at the library)
This program will provide an opportunity for English language learners to practice vocabulary, pronunciation and grammar in a fun, comfortable, laid-back environment. Register at the library’s website calendar.

Plants as Muse: Mugwort with Nora Toomey
Tuesday, Dec. 7, 7 p.m. (Zoom)
Mugwort, or Artemisia vulgaris, is a plant that is woven so deeply into the folklore and mythology of countless cultures around the world. It is an ancient plant, rich with story, magic and medicine. In this one-hour class, participants will explore the imagery, deities, planetary rulings and magical properties associated with mugwort and will be led through creative prompts inspired by mugwort that will unleash their own storytelling, poem-writing or art-making power. Participants should bring a notebook and painting, drawing or collage supplies. The first 20 registrants will be able to pick up a pouch of mugwort from the library. Register at the library’s website calendar.
